锘緻charset "utf-8";

/*end*/



/**/

.newsbj{/* height:835px; */}

.news{/* padding-top:74px; */}

.news h2{text-align: center; height:73px; font-size: 38px; color:#242424; line-height: 38px;}

.news .newsnav{height:90px;}

.news .newsnav ul{width:600px;float:left;}

.news .newsnav ul li{float:left;width:208px;padding-left:21px; border-left:3px solid #6d6d6d;box-sizing: border-box;}

.news .newsnav ul li i{display: block;font-size: 14px; line-height: 14px; color:#242424;opacity: 0.8; margin-bottom: 8px;}

.news .newsnav ul li em{display: block;font-size: 24px; color:#242424;line-height: 24px;  }

.news .newsnav ul li:hover{ border-left:3px solid #484848;}

.news .newsnav ul li:hover em{font-weight: bold;}

.news .newsnav span{display: block; float:right;margin-top: 14px;}

.news .newsnav span a{font-size: 16px; color:#242424;padding-right:31px; background:url(../images/jia.png) no-repeat right;}

.news .newsdesc{height: 382px;}

.news .newsdesc .newst{width:600px;height:338px;position: relative;float:left;}

.news .newsdesc .newst .newt{width:600px;height:338px;position: relative;}

.news .newsdesc .newst .newt span{display: block;width:600px;height:338px;border-radius:30px 0px 30px 0px; overflow: hidden;}

.news .newsdesc .newst .newt span img{width:600px;height:338px;border-radius:30px 0px 30px 0px;}

.news .newsdesc .newst .newt h4{display: block;width:599px;height:54px;line-height: 54px;background:url(../images/yy4.png) no-repeat center; position: absolute;left:0;bottom:0;border-radius:0px 0px 30px 0px; overflow: hidden;}

.news .newsdesc .newst .newt h4 a{padding-left:33px;font-size: 16px; color:#FFF; font-weight: normal;}

.news .newsdesc .newst .qh{width:206px; height:54px;background:#FFF;border-radius:30px 0px 30px 0px;position: absolute;right:0;bottom:0;}

.news .newsdesc .newst .qh ul{width:119px;height:54px;padding-top:23px; padding-left:30px; box-sizing: border-box; float:left; }

.news .newsdesc .newst .qh ul li{float:left;width:9px; height:9px; border-radius: 50%;background:#A4A4A4; margin-right: 11px;}

.news .newsdesc .newst .qh ul li.cur{background:#1C4B90;}

.news .newsdesc .newst .qh .jt{width:69px; float:left;padding-top:11px; height:54px; box-sizing: border-box;background:url(../images/hg.jpg) no-repeat center;}

.news .newsdesc .newst .qh .jt i{display: block; width:34px; height:34px; float:left;cursor: pointer;}

.news .newsdesc .newst .qh .jt .prev1{background:url(../images/prev1.png) no-repeat center;margin-right: 1px;}

.news .newsdesc .newst .qh .jt .next1{background:url(../images/next1.png) no-repeat center;}

.news .newsdesc .mewsfl{width: 567px;float:right;}

.news .newsdesc .mewsfl dl{height: 73px;margin-bottom: 21px;}

.news .newsdesc .mewsfl dl dt{width: 60px;float:left;}

.news .newsdesc .mewsfl dl dt i{display: block;font-size: 18px; line-height: 18px; color:#242424; margin-bottom: 15px;}

.news .newsdesc .mewsfl dl dt em{display: block;font-size: 19px;color:#242424;line-height: 14px;}

.news .newsdesc .mewsfl dl dd{width: 480px;float:left;}

.news .newsdesc .mewsfl dl dd p{font-size: 15px;color:#525252;}

.news .gyjj{height:182px;}

.news .gyjj ul li{float:left;width:305px;height:152px;border-right:1px solid #d6d6d6;padding:0 70px;}

.news .gyjj ul li.first{padding-left:0;}

.news .gyjj ul li.last{padding-right:0;border-right:0;}

.news .gyjj ul li h4{display: block; height:34px; margin-bottom: 18px;}

.news .gyjj ul li h4 i{display: block;width:35px; height:34px;text-align:center; line-height:34px;float:left; margin-right: 13px; font-size: 16px; color:#EEEEEE;background:url(../images/qbj.png) no-repeat center;font-weight:normal;}

.news .gyjj ul li h4 a{display: block; float:left;font-size: 16px; color:#333333; line-height: 34px; font-weight: bold;}

.news .gyjj ul li p{padding-left:50px; font-size: 14px; color:#525252;}
/* 娓呴櫎鍐呭杈硅窛 */

@charset "utf-8";

body, h1, h2, h3, h4, h5, h6, hr, p, blockquote, /* structural elements 缁撴瀯鍏冪礌 */

dl, dt, dd, ul, ol, li, /* list elements 鍒楄〃鍏冪礌 */

pre, /* text formatting elements 鏂囨湰鏍煎紡鍏冪礌 */

fieldset,button, input, textarea, /* form elements 琛ㄥ崟鍏冪礌 */

th, td { /* table elements 琛ㄦ牸鍏冪礌 */

    margin: 0;

    padding: 0;

}

.content{ width:1200px;margin: 0 auto;}



input,textarea {border:  none; box-shadow: none; outline: none;}



/* 璁剧疆榛樿瀛椾綋 */

body,

button, input, select, textarea {

    font: 16px/22px "Microsoft YaHei";color: #666;

}



h1 {font-size: 18px;font-family: "Microsoft Yahei";}

h2 {font-size: 16px;font-family: "Microsoft Yahei";}

h3 {font-size: 14px; font-family: "Microsoft Yahei"; font-weight:normal;}

h4, h5, h6 {font-size: 100%;}

* h1,* h2,* h3,* h4,* h5,* h6{margin: 0px;} /*瑕嗙洊bootstrape瀵规爣棰樺姞鐨勯粯璁ゅ杈硅窛*/



address, cite, dfn, em, i, var {font-style: normal;} /* 鏂滀綋鎵舵 */



/* 閲嶇疆鍒楄〃鍏冪礌 */

ul, ol ,li{list-style: none;}



/* 閲嶇疆鏂囨湰鏍煎紡鍏冪礌 */

a {text-decoration: none; color: #666; word-wrap:break-word;}/*鑻辨枃鎹㈣*/

a:hover {text-decoration: none; color:#666;}





/* 閲嶇疆琛ㄥ崟鍏冪礌 */

legend {color: #000;} /* for ie6 */

fieldset, img {border: none;} /* img 鎼溅锛氳閾炬帴閲岀殑 img 鏃犺竟妗 */

/* 娉細optgroup 鏃犳硶鎵舵 */

button, input, select, textarea {

    font-size: 100%; /* 浣胯〃鍗曞厓绱犲湪 ie 涓嬭兘缁ф壙瀛椾綋澶у皬 */

}

input[type="text"],input[type="button"], input[type="submit"], input[type="reset"]{

	-webkit-appearance: none;}

textarea {-webkit-appearance: none;}



/* 閲嶇疆琛ㄦ牸鍏冪礌 */

table {

    border-collapse: collapse;

    border-spacing: 0;

}



/* 璁╅潪ie娴忚鍣ㄩ粯璁や篃鏄剧ず鍨傜洿婊氬姩鏉★紝闃叉鍥犳粴鍔ㄦ潯寮曡捣鐨勯棯鐑 */

html {overflow-y: scroll;}



/*璁剧疆娴姩*/

.fl {float: left;}

.fr {float: right;}

.pr{position: relative;}

.pa{position: absolute;}



/*瀛椾綋澶у皬*/

.fz12{font-size: 12px;}

.fz14{font-size: 14px;}

.fz16{font-size: 16px;}

.fz18{font-size: 18px;}

.fz20{font-size: 20px;}

.fz22{font-size: 22px;}

.clear{clear: both;height: 0;}

.clearfix:after{height: 0;content: "";clear: both;display: block;}

.blk-main .clearlist{ clear:both;height:0;padding:0;margin:0;border:0;width:100% ;float:none;}









/*琛ㄥ崟寮规*/



.nsw-modal {

	width: 100%;

	height: 100%;

	background: rgba(225, 225, 225, 0.5);

	position: fixed;

	top: 0;

	left: 0;

	z-index: 99999;

}



.modal-dialog {

	position: fixed;

	color: #000000;

	top: 150px;

	width: 400px;

	border-radius: 3px;

	min-height: 155px;

	overflow: hidden;

	z-index: 99998;

	margin-left: -200px;

	left: 50%;

}



.modal-dialog .css-icon {



}



.modal-dialog .modal-head {

	height: 30px;

	line-height: 30px;

	padding: 0px 20px;

	background: #F6EFEF;

	font-size: 14px;

}



.modal-dialog .modal-head .modal-logo {

	width: 15px;

	height: 15px;

	background-position: 1px 0px;

	margin: 8px 5px 0 0;

	float: left;

}



.modal-dialog .modal-head .close {

	float: right;

	width: 15px;

	height: 15px;

	background-position: -14px 0px;

	margin-top: 8px;

}



.modal-dialog .modal-body {

	width: 100%;

	min-height: 125px;

	background: #ffffff;

}



.modal-dialog .modal-body .modal-body-left {

	width: 140px;

	float: left;

}



.modal-dialog .modal-body .modal-body-left .icon {

	width: 64px;

	height: 64px;

	margin: 30px 0 0 48px;

}



.modal-dialog .modal-body .modal-body-left .success-message {

	background-position: 0px -14px;

}



.modal-dialog .modal-body .modal-body-left .warming-message {

	background-position: 0px -78px;

}



.modal-dialog .modal-body .modal-body-right {

	width: 260px;

	float: right;

	padding-top: 20px;

}



.modal-dialog .modal-body .modal-body-right .close-btn {

	color: #000;

	text-align: center;

	width: 90px;

	display: inline-block;

	height: 24px;

	line-height: 24px;

	background: #818079;

}

.bottom_xl{height:30px;line-height:30px;font-size: 14px;}


.bottom1{ color:#ffffff;}
.bottom1 a{ color:#ffffff}
.bottom1 a:hover{ color:#ffffff}

.bottom2{ color:#ffffff;}
.bottom2 a{ color:#ffffff}
.bottom2 a:hover{ color:#ffffff}

.modal-dialog .modal-body .modal-body-right p {

	line-height: 30px;

}